- The distance between Chico, Chile and Jendouba, Tunisia is approximately 12,222 km or 7,595 mi.
- To reach Chico in this distance one would set out from Jendouba bearing 226.1°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Chico bearing 237.5° or WSW .
- Chico is in or near the boreal rain forest biome whereas Jendouba is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 8.6 °C (15.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.1 °C (7.4°F) less in Chico.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 158.6 mm (6.2 in) less which is equivalent to 158.6 l/m² (3.89 US gal/ft²) or 1,586,000 l/ha (169,554 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.7° lower in Chico than in Jendouba.
- Relative humidity levels are 6.2%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 9.6°C (17.3°F) lower.
